The Benefits of a fridge lg Undercounter

Undercounter refrigerators allow you to easily access your refrigerated goods while making space in larger refrigerators or freestanding units. They come with doors made of solid material or glass, and some manufacturers offer ADA-height units designed to fit under an ADA-compliant countertop.

russell-hobbs-rhuclf2w-freestanding-undeUnlike freestanding fridges, undercounter models vent to the front, meaning they don't have to be enclosed between cabinets in the kitchen. They also have a more attractive appearance.

Space Saving

By adding an undercounter refrigerator to your bar or kitchen it will make space for the main fridge. This is a great idea for small spaces where you need to store extra drinks or food but don't have room for a full-sized unit.

Refrigerator undercounter models range in sizes from 24" to 119". Some models are smaller and are suitable for smaller layouts. Some are more substantial and are compatible with thicker countertops. You can plan your installation by following the guidelines for clearance that are provided in the specifications sheets of each model. If you have limited space available, choose one with a front-breathing design that has its intake and exhaust at the front of the fridge for minimum cabinet depth requirements.

Certain undercounter refrigerators feature glass doors, whereas others have an interior with drawers. Both models are easy to access and can help a space look more streamlined.

Drawer models compromise some energy efficiency in order to give you more space to store food pans. They are great for self-service areas that require items organized and accessible for customers. The glass-fronted units let you see what's inside. Also, ADA-compliant units are available with shorter legs that fit under counters to accommodate wheelchair users.

A variety of undercounter refrigerators can serve as a beverage center. They are ideal for chilled snacks and bottled drinks. You can pick from a variety of finish options such as stainless steel and panel-ready to complement your kitchen's design.

Convenience

If you're short on space for a big refrigerator or do not want to go through the hassle of moving a heavy refrigerator, an undercounter fridge might be the solution you require. These versatile units can store anything from extra drinks to food items, party trays including condiments, trays, and more. They are also easier to clean than larger cabinets.

The most well-known undercounter refrigeration models are single-door chillers that measure 27 inches wide and contain around 7 cubic feet. However, you can also find two-door models that are up to 93 inches wide and hold up to 12 cubic feet of storage space. You can also find a double-door model with an integrated tap for beer, which would be ideal for pubs or bars.

Most units come with solid doors. However there are also glass door options for those who want customers to view what's inside. Some undercounter units are pass-through units that allow you to open them and close from both sides. This feature is great for banquet kitchens as it allows them to use a FIFO system (first in and last out).

Another benefit of these units of refrigeration under counter is their sleek, compact design that fits easily under counters and into cabinets without taking up valuable floor space. They're made to work with a built-in ice maker or an ice container. Many manufacturers offer models with panel capabilities that can be trimmed to fit with the cabinetry.

These refrigerator counters aren't only space-saving, but also offer convenience for bars, restaurants, and homes. They are particularly useful in kitchens with small spaces as an overflow or for storing items needed right away. Some models are specifically designed to serve drinks such as beer and wine while others can be modified to accommodate food items that are specific. Many are ADA compatible. This means they can be operated even by people who have physical disabilities. Some are also low-profile which makes them easy to integrate in smaller spaces. They're usually less expensive than larger undercounter refrigerators, making them an ideal choice to add storage space to a small area.

Energy Efficiency

If you're looking for an eco friendly refrigerator, the good news is that refrigerators under the counter are becoming more and more energy efficient. Manufacturers are designing these appliances using materials that aren't so ozone depleting and also use modern technology for cooling and freezing which are less harmful to the environment.

There are many options to choose from for you to replace an undercounter refrigerator or include refrigeration in your kitchen area, or create a full service bar. These refrigerators can be as small as 27 inches wide with 7 cubic feet of interior space, or as big as 93 inches, with up to 40 cubic feet of storage. Stainless steel is the most popular material, however some models are also available in aluminum.

Many undercounter refrigerators are designed to meet the needs of a commercial kitchen with heavy use. They're also built to be sleek and compact for a clean, modern design that complements the style of any business or home.

They can be used as an overflow for larger refrigerators or be used as a beverage center or wine cooler. They can store fresh produce as well as condiments, trays for parties and other items to make them accessible. Some can be converted into a freezer for additional storage capacity for food items.

The most common kind of undercounter refrigerator is the single-door Freestanding Fridge refrigerator. It is 27 inches wide and has a capacity of 7 cubic feet. If you require more space for storage inside there are double-door models that begin at 48 inches wide with up to 12 cubic feet of space.

Some refrigerators under counters are ADA-compliant and come with shorter legs, which makes it easier to access them underneath the counter. They can be helpful for people in wheelchairs who do not have enough space to install a bigger fridge underneath the counter.

Many undercounter fridges are designed to keep the exact temperature even when empty. This is crucial when it comes to food items that must be kept in a safe environment, like medicines or vaccines. Some are equipped with a digital display that allow you to easily check the internal temperature.

Design

Fridge undercounter models have a sleek look without the weight of upright refrigerators. In contrast to mini and freestanding fridges, which vent at the back, undercounter refrigerators have an innovative design that allows them to sit snugly against cabinets or walls and fit under counters without the gap that mini and freestanding fridge (why not try this out) fridges require. This helps create an effective workspace that doesn't hinder traffic flow and allows staff to work without being interrupted by the fridge's presence.

You can select from a variety of styles and sizes to find the right refrigerator for you. They are available in dual-temperature or single-temperature units, based on the requirements of your establishment. The majority of them have the 430 stainless steel exterior which is tough and attractive. Some models come with an recessed handle to enhance functionality and remove the need for extra cabinet space.

The refrigerator under counter is a great option for medical facilities with limited storage space. It allows staff to make the most of the space available for equipment and supplies as well as to keep refrigerated food and medication sitting out on countertops where it could be easily knocked over by visitors or patients. In addition to their practicality, these fridges are designed for outstanding durability to ensure they stand up to high usage and frequent cleaning.
